Problem
Existing systems face challenges in securely generating documents containing confidential information without exposing them to low-trust networks, risking theft and misuse, which can lead to liability and revenue loss.
Innovation Solution
A mechanism is provided where confidential information is stored in a high-trust network, with tokens generated and embedded in documents in a low-trust network, allowing the high-trust network to replace tokens with actual information, ensuring secure document generation and presentation.

If confidential information is provided to a vendor in a low-trust network for document generation, then the vendor can generate the document, but the confidential information is exposed to theft and misuse risks
Solution Approach 1:
The patent introduces a token as an intermediary element that replaces confidential information in documents sent to vendors. The token serves as a mediator between the high-trust network (where confidential information is stored) and the low-trust network (where document generation occurs). The vendor receives documents with tokens instead of actual confidential information, generating documents without exposing sensitive data. The high-trust network then replaces tokens with actual confidential information before final delivery to the user.
Solution Approach 2:
The patent segments the document generation process into distinct phases: (1) generating a document template with tokens in the low-trust network, (2) replacing tokens with actual confidential information in the high-trust network, and (3) delivering the final document to the user. This segmentation allows the vendor to participate in document generation without accessing the actual confidential information, resolving the contradiction between enabling vendor document generation and preventing information theft.

Mechanisms for generating documents with confidential information are provided, the systems comprising: a memory; and a first collection of at least of one hardware processor coupled to the memory and configured to: receive from a user device a request for a first document with confidential information; generate a second document, that corresponds to the first document, with at least one token corresponding to the confidential information; transmit the second document to a second collection of at least one hardware processor in a computer network that is entitled to access the confidential information; receive from the second collection of at least one hardware processor in the computer network a uniform resource locator (URL) corresponding to the first document; and transmit the URL to the user device. In some of these mechanisms, the user device is in the computer network.
